Output ea76653091ecb18be462c84ca5aa58d9aca924b73daa20f21575662117d30289:1

value
812790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 371d9b113ae7aedb7cca2100b77515229a8af1bd OP_EQUAL
address
36iSZ8tCMM1KTbiQBm29qNDBzZ5TySXCgd
transaction
ea76653091ecb18be462c84ca5aa58d9aca924b73daa20f21575662117d30289
spent
true